    Just got my i8600 today, after FOUR grueling days of waiting... lol dell has a miraculous shipping system, since the ram i bought for the laptop 2 weeks ago hasnt even gotten here yet.


    1.8 ghz intel centrino /w wsxga+
    256 mb pc2700 ram [waiting for the 1 gig of ram to come in]
    60 gb 7200 rpm hd
    128mb radeon 9600
    cdrw/dvd combo


    First impressions: Seems very solid, although it does overheat on the backsite a little. I still dont know what keyboard flex is, and im probably not going to since this keyboard is very solid. The resolution on the wsxga monitor is insane.. everything is very very clear, and easy to read. The touchpad seems to be a little quirky, after i have my finger on the left click, it would inadvertently click.. but that alright since my usb mouse perfectly matches the color scheme of this laptop, and ill be using that.

    This laptop was quite a bit bigger than i thought it was going to be, but that's better i guess.
